ABAP Runtime Errors

DB_ERR_RSQL_00022 SAP ABAP Runtime Error db err rsql 00022







DB_ERR_RSQL_00022 is an ABAP runtime error which you may come across when using or developing within an SAP system. See below for the standard details explaining what it means and how you can avoid or fix this runtime error.

Short Dump Classification: & - Text Include (no Short Dump, only Text Module)

You can view further information about a runtme error by using transaction code ST22 which will show you this and all runtime erros that have happen in your SAP system.

Also check out the Comments section below to view or add related contributions and example screen shots.


DB_ERR_RSQL_00022 ABAP Runtime Error

Correct the affected SAP Open SQL statement as required.

Please see send to abap for more details about the possible cause of this runtime error and how it could be avoided.

Please see internal call code for more details about the possible cause of this runtime error and how it could be avoided.

The maximum length of a long field has been exceeded. Please see abap error for more details about the possible cause of this runtime error and how it could be avoided.

The maximum length of the long field of the specified table is defined in the ABAP Dictionary. The current length of the long field corresponds to the value of the previous field, which must be a numerical field.

In this case, the value in this field was greater than the maximum value defined for the long field in the ABAP Dictionary.

"Long" fields are all fields defined in the ABAP Dictionary with the data type STRING, RAWSTRING, LCHR, or LRAW. Please see abap error for more details about the possible cause of this runtime error and how it could be avoided.